Evolus Inc. (EOLS) traded at $4.12 as of market close on 2026-04-09, notching a modest 0.61% gain on the day. This analysis focuses on the stock’s recent trading dynamics, key technical price levels, and potential near-term scenarios, as no recent earnings data is publicly available for the company as of this writing.
